Small abstract artwork on primed wood panel - in cheerful bright tones of pink. Inspired by LGBTQ parade in New York City. 2.5 " thick sides are finished with liquid gold paint: when hit with light they cast beautiful gold shadows on the wall.

I was born and raised in St. Petersburg, Russia, my mother is renowned impressionistic painter of cityscapes. I spent a lot of time in her studio growing up, helping her with priming the canvases and paint mixing at first and later – making underpaintings for her work. I always gravitated towards graphic type of art, but painting always reminded me of my mother’s studio and my first connection with the artworld I made there. I have received a BA degree in graphic arts and later a PhD in communications studies. My entire life, I have been making my living by creating visual stories for brands and personalities. But I have never stopped painting and curated a number of art shows in Russia and USA. Fine art has always been a source of inspiration and an unrestricted outlet for creative experimentation. My curiosity for exploring different artistic styles and mediums eventually brought me to early Christian art – icons and frescoes with elements of gilding. I use watercolors and different mixtures of stucco and gesso to imitate that matte effect of a fresco painting and finish my artwork with goldleaf, often gilding the sides of wood panels to give painting a glowing halo effect – goldleaf reflects on the walls when painting is hung. My work style is best described as temporal psychoexpressionism, I capture the remnants of the fleeting feelings one has in evocative places. I live close to New York City, and my most recent work is inspired by its vibes. I explore and record the intersections of tradition and innovation by applying traditional mediums to modern abstract visual concepts. My art merges past, present, and future in one moment in an attempt to capture the feeling of absolute timelessness. I find that megalopolises such as New York invert, twist, grind and mix eras of time together like layers of paint to produce unexpected results. Ultimately my art aims to encourage the viewer to experience every moment of their life with full awareness, as everything surrounding us is only temporary.
